Output 17b9ca1f8e4701f64322f62499c151fea2eb6b0710f589143e066a14f3e04e64:0

value
37612880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bf037f3015f61b76f07717313aa7a2592f45062 OP_EQUAL
address
34EjwQCPuUBFaUeZ4WYSjiKAmJRKvE3jUK
transaction
17b9ca1f8e4701f64322f62499c151fea2eb6b0710f589143e066a14f3e04e64
spent
true